什么是MySQL
MySQL是一种开放源码的关系型数据库管理系统,它支持多用户的同时访问,提供了对SQL语言的强大支持,为开发者提供了一种可靠、高效的数据存储解决方案。MySQL可以运行在多种操作系统上,包括Windows、Linux、Unix等,它是世界上最流行的开源数据库之一。
MySQL语句
MySQL中的语句可以分为多种,包括数据定义语言(DDL)、数据操纵语言(DML)、数据查询语言(DQL)等,其中DML是对数据进行操作,包括插入、更新、删除等。而MySQL的语句是以关键字和选项为主要形式的。其中关键字是指用来控制操作的单词,而选项则是关键字的一些附属参数,用于指定具体的操作需求。
MySQL语句中的‘c’选项
‘c’选项的含义
在MySQL语句中,‘c’选项是指在运行查询时,将结果分类显示出来。这种分类依据是通过使用GROUP BY子句来实现的。如果用户在查询时使用了‘c’选项,则查询结果将按照用户指定的列进行分类统计,以便用户更清晰地得到所需要的数据。
‘c’选项的使用
‘c’选项的使用需要满足以下语法格式:
SELECT column_name(s)
FROM table_name
WHERE condition
GROUP BY column_name(s)
ORDER BY column_name(s);
在上述语法中,SELECT关键字用于指定需要查询的列名,可以是具体的列名,也可以是(*)通配符。
FROM关键字用于指定查询的数据表名。
WHERE关键字用于筛选查询结果,只有满足条件的数据才会出现在最终的查询结果中。
GROUP BY关键字用于指定按照哪个列进行分类,如果指定了GROUP BY子句,则查询结果将按照该列进行分类,并进行统计分析。
ORDER BY关键字用于对查询结果进行排序,可以按照升序或者降序排列。
以下是一个‘c’选项的实例,对一个学生的考试成绩进行分类统计。
SELECT COUNT(*), score
FROM student
GROUP BY score;
上述语句将会返回每个分数段的学生数量。
总结
在开发过程中,我们经常需要对大量数据进行统计分析,而MySQL中的‘c’选项可以为我们提供一个快捷、高效的分类统计方法。通过使用GROUP BY子句,我们可以按照所需的条件进行分类,并对分类结果进行统计分析,从而得到我们需要的数据。